The Floor Adhesive That Cost Me 3 Hours of Sleep & $600 Worth of Rework
I thought I had this one figured out
In early 2023, I was tasked with sourcing flooring adhesives for a 15,000-square-foot office renovation. Our operations manager wanted something that could handle heavy foot traffic, and I found what looked like a great deal on a standard polyurethane adhesive. The price was about 20% lower than what I'd budgeted. I felt pretty good about it.
Three weeks later, I didn't feel good at all.
The adhesive didn't bond properly with the concrete substrate—something a technical datasheet would've told me if I'd bothered to read it carefully. Within six weeks, tiles were lifting. We had to rip out 400 square feet, re-prep the surface, and reapply with the right product. The total cost: about $600 in materials and labor I hadn't planned for. And that doesn't include the headache of coordinating the rework or the annoyed emails from the team whose desks were displaced.
That experience changed how I think about sourcing building materials. It's tempting to think you can just compare unit prices and pick the lowest one. But that approach ignores a bunch of hidden costs that can wreck your budget.
The surface problem: 'Which one is cheaper?'
Most buyers, including me back then, focus on the sticker price. I'd get three quotes for a sika floor adhesive, pick the lowest per-gallon cost, and move on. I thought I was doing my job.
But here's the thing: the unit price is just the beginning. I've learned that the real question isn't "what's your best price?" It's "what's included in that price?"
Things I didn't think to ask about until they cost me money:
- Substrate compatibility — Will the adhesive work on concrete, plywood, or existing coatings? If not, you're looking at primers or surface prep costs.
- Cure time — Faster curing means less downtime for the worksite. Slower curing means extra days of disruption.
- Application method — Is it trowel-grade or can it be spray-applied? Different methods mean different labor costs.
- Cleanup requirements — Some adhesives need special solvents. That's an extra line item.
These are all part of the total cost of ownership, and they add up fast.
The deeper issue: Why we keep making this mistake
It's easy to blame myself for not checking the details. But I think the real problem is a broader misconception about what "cost" means in a B2B purchasing context.
Most people think of cost as the price on the invoice. But in my experience, that's maybe 60-70% of the actual cost. The rest is hidden in:
- Time spent managing issues — The week I spent coordinating the rework for that floor adhesive? That's time I didn't spend on other purchasing tasks. My department doesn't bill hours, but it still has a cost.
- Risk of delays — When a product fails, the project timeline shifts. That can lead to penalties or frustrated internal clients.
- Potential need for redos — The $600 rework cost was direct. But I also had to re-order materials, manage vendor returns, and explain the situation to my boss. That's not cheap.
It's tempting to think you can avoid all this by just picking a well-known brand. And sure, a brand like sika has a reputation for quality. But even then, you need to pick the right product for the specific application. A wood adhesive that works great on plywood might not be the best choice for concrete.
The question everyone asks is "what's your best price?" The question they should ask is "what's included in that price?"
The real cost of getting it wrong
Let me break down what that "cheaper" floor adhesive actually cost us:
- Direct material cost: $1,200 (initial order) + $400 (replacement order) = $1,600
- Labor for rework: $600 (contractor rate for removal and reapplication)
- Downtime: 3 days of disrupted workspace. Hard to quantify, but it affects morale.
- My time: Roughly 8-10 hours of coordination, calls, and paperwork. At my internal rate, call it $400.
- Reputation cost: I had to explain to my VP why a project went over budget. That's not a fun conversation.
The original quote was about $200 less than a better-suited product. But the total cost ended up being way higher. That's the TCO gap in action.
What I do now (and what you might consider)
I don't think there's a perfect system. But I've started using a simple checklist before I place any order for building materials:
- Check the technical datasheet. This is non-negotiable. I look for substrate compatibility, application temperature range, and cure time.
- Calculate TCO. I add up: unit price + shipping + estimated prep cost + estimated labor cost + contingency (10-15% of total for unexpected issues).
- Ask about minimums and lead times. A product that's in stock and ships fast is worth more than one that's backordered for 3 weeks.
- Look for a product that matches the specific use case. For example, a sika wood adhesive is designed for wood-to-wood bonding. A sika floor adhesive is for subfloor applications. They're not interchangeable.
This approach isn't perfect. I still make mistakes—just fewer of them. And I've saved a lot more in avoided rework costs than I've spent on slightly more expensive products.
